Sri Agasthiar The Day of the Flawless Gem - Apr/29/2ØØØ

Maasu = flaw.
Ilaa = without.
Mani = gem.
Thus Maasilaa = flawless,
Maasilaamani = flawless gem and Maasilaamani Eesvara = The Lord in the aspect of the flawless gem!

Who in this universe can claim to be flawless but the Supreme Lord and Master Maasilaamani Eesvara? The Lord alone is flawless in every way. He's the One who is pure in every aspect. This eternally pure, flawless aspect of the Lord is visible to us in the divine Svayambu Lingam form of Sri Maasilaa Mani Eesvara in a place called Thiru Mullai Vaayil near Chennai (Madras).

This form of the Lord is perennially bathed in sandalwood paste. But every year, on the day of the Sadhayam nakshatram in the Chithirai maasam, the year old sandalwood paste is removed and a new coat applied for the next year. So it's only on this day and that too for a short time that one can view the bare Svayambu Lingam form of the Lord. The Siddhas refer to this vision of the Lord as the Darshan of the Light of Eternal Truth. This vision which is available to us only for a few hours each year must be seen by everyone of us, irrespective of race, religion or nationality, say the Siddhas.

The Cure for All Ills
Siva Lingam On the day of the Flawless Gem, the sandalwood paste which had been in contact with the Lord's divine form, for a year will be distributed to the devotees. This potent sandalwood paste prasadam is charged with the power of Lord Maasilaa Mani; it's a cure for all ills; it can cure all diseases and it's an antidote for bad karma. Wear it daily on your forehead with faith and devotion.

Just near the sanctum of the Flawless Gem, you can see two pillars made of white erukku. There are many Siddha medicinal secrets associated with these blessed pillars. They are the home of many celestial angelic beings well versed in medicine who are authorized to cure those devotees afflicted with what may seem to be incurable diseases and bodily problems, particularly uterine diseases, diseases of the stomach and abdominal cavity, skin diseases and diseases of the nervous system. These devotees are advised by the Siddhas to circle these pillars and to offer the gift of sesame (gingelly) oil, coconut oil and shikakai powder to the poor and the needy. Furthermore, they should make the white colored ven pongal dish and offer it to the poor. This is the Siddha prescription for redemption for these people.
